Understanding Heavy-Duty Motorcycle Rainwear


Heavy-duty motorcycle rainwear is designed to offer maximum protection against the elements while maintaining a level of comfort that allows for ease of movement. Unlike regular rain gear, heavy-duty options are constructed from durable materials that resist tearing and wear, ensuring long-lasting performance. These rain suits typically come with features such as


1. Waterproofing The first and foremost feature of any good rainwear is its ability to keep you dry. High-quality rain suits use advanced waterproof fabrics that prevent water from seeping in while still allowing sweat to escape, ensuring the rider remains comfortable.


2. Breathability Heavy-duty rainwear often employs breathable membranes that regulate temperature. This prevents overheating during warm rain showers, making the gear more comfortable for extended wear.


3. Visibility Safety is paramount while riding in rainy conditions. Many heavy-duty motorcycle rainwear options come with reflective strips that enhance visibility in low-light conditions, making it easier for other road users to see you.


4. Durability Heavy-duty fabric enhances the lifespan of rainwear. Look for reinforced seams and heavy stitching, which prevent water from leaking through vulnerable areas.


5. Fit and Mobility While it’s essential for rainwear to be waterproof, it should not restrict movement. A good fit allows for layering underneath without compromising on mobility or comfort.


6. Storage Many heavy-duty rainwear options come equipped with pockets for storing essentials while on the road. Some even include a cadre bag, making it easy to pack up the gear when it’s not in use.

Selecting the right rainwear involves considering several factors to ensure it meets your specific needs


1. Size and Fit Proper sizing is crucial for any motorcycle gear. Heavy-duty rainwear should fit over your regular riding gear without being too tight or too loose, ensuring comfort while riding.


2. Weather Conditions Consider the typical weather conditions you’ll be riding in. If you often encounter heavy rain or extreme weather, invest in higher-quality, fully waterproof gear.


3. Type of Riding Casual riding may require different gear compared to long-distance touring. Ensure the gear you choose aligns with your riding style and duration.


4. Layering Options During colder months, the ability to layer underneath your rain suit can enhance comfort. Look for designs that accommodate additional layers without restricting movement.


5. Customer Reviews Learning from the experiences of other riders can greatly assist your decision. Look for gear that has positive reviews concerning its waterproof capabilities and overall durability.


6. Brand Reputation Opt for rainwear from reputable brands known for producing high-quality motorcycle clothing. Established brands often have a track record of reliability and durability.
